SECTION TV — STATISTICS AND TABLES
The following statistical information relating to the Borough has
been completed on receipt of the Local and National Statistics issued
by the Registrar-General in connection with Population, Birth-rate,
Death-rates, Maternal Mortality, Infantile Mortality, and Incidence of
Notifiable Infectious Disease.
TABLE 1. —STATISTICAL SUMMARY, 1957
Area | 2,650 acres | |||
Population:— | ||||
Census, 1931 | 42,44C | |||
Census, 1951 | 40,558 | |||
Registrar Generals estimate, mid-1957 | 39,51C | |||
Number of inhabited houses | 12,11C | |||
Rateable Value | £849,067 | |||
Product of a penny rate | £3,40C | |||
Number of Live Births:— | ||||
Males | Females | Total | ||
Legitimate | 204 | 207 | 411 | |
Illegitimate | 14 | 16 | 30 | |
Totals | 218 | 223 | 441 | |
Birth Rate per 1,000 population:— | ||||
Uncorrected | 11.2 | |||
Corrected (Comparability Factor 1.0) | 11.2 | |||
Males | Females | Total | ||
Number of Stillbirths | 3 | 2 | 5 | |
Stillbirth rate per 1,000 total births | 11.2 | |||
Males | Females | Total | ||
Number of Deaths | 238 | 278 | 516 | |
Death Rate per 1,000 population: | ||||
Uncorrected | 13.1 | |||
Corrected (Comparability Factor 0.75) | 9.8 | |||
Deaths from Puerperal Causes | NIL | |||
Death Rate of Infants under one year of age:— | ||||
All Infants per 1,000 live births | 20.4 | |||
Legitimate infants per 1,000 legitimate live births | 21.9 | |||
Illegitimate infants per 1,000 illegitimate live births | NIL | |||
Deaths from Cancer (all ages) | 97 | |||
Deaths from Measles (all ages) | NIL | |||
Deaths from Whooping Cough (all ages) | NIL | |||
Deaths from Diarrhoea (under 2 years of age) | NIL | |||
There has been no unusual or excessive mortality during the year. |
